CPD Activities:
SWME functions as a liaison between world renowned medical facilities, international medical associations, pharmaceutical agencies and medical communications companies to promote in-person medical exchange.
SWME’s CPD activities are offered either through the existing programs of medical associations, or by developing customized activities tailored to the particular audience’s educational and scientific needs. Activities are provided at top healthcare institutions and cover many distinct medical fields, including topics in public healthcare, primary care and in the most highly specialized clinical care.
Multi-disciplinary areas of focus may include:
- Allergy
- Clinical immunology
- Infectious diseases
- Respiratory infections
- Diabetes
- Metabolic diseases
- Rheumatology
For each activity, the SWME teams up with leading medical associations and local experts to develop the curriculum select a faculty comprised of leaders in their field. Activities can be in the format of ground rounds, live surgery, lectures and case study presentations. SWME also provides logistical support for course design and implementation.
Who Can Participate?
CPD activities facilitated by the SWME are open to all generalists and specialist physicians wishing to advance in their particular health care field. However, only doctors from developing countries are eligible for SWME sponsorship.
